B.C.-based compostable materials tech company Nexe Innovations has made two key executive appointments.

Chris Murray, formerly the vice president of sales and marketing at Zavida Coffee Company, takes up the same title at Nexe. Kam Mangat has been named VP of investor relations and corporate strategy

Murray has more than 20 years experience in the CPG industry in Canada and the U.S. 

Before Zavida Coffee, where he worked for eight years, Murray was category marketing manager of retail coffee at Mother Parkers Tea and Coffee. Prior to that, he was senior brand manager, business development, for Tree of Life/KeHe.

Mangat, meanwhile, was most recently VP, relationship management, at a consulting firm covering U.S. and Canadian pension plans. With more than 20 years experience in finance, she has also worked in capital markets as a sell-side equity analyst.

"After commercializing and beta testing the Nexe coffee pod, we are now keenly focused on growing sales. The appointment of Chris Murray, a seasoned CPG salesperson with a proven track record will ensure that we are positioned to be the market leader in the single-serve industry. The appointment of Kam Mangat will enhance our focus on capital markets and corporate strategy to help build internal operations to support our growth," said Ash Guglani, president of Nexe Innovations. "We expect that the new appointments will significantly strengthen our team as we focus on executing on our strategy.”
